Syllabus
Syllabus
Structure and system concept for the organization of training in Gymnastics Gymnastics organizational structure at national and international level Regulations Terminology Judges rules Gym equipment: Characteristics, Handling, instalation and safety rules Training Methodology in Gymnastics Physical training. Motor Skills. Physical preparation. Planning of training sessions Technical Training, pedagogical progressions, manual intervention in the disciplines of: Women's and Men's Artistic Gymnastics Trampoline Acrobatic gymnastics Gymnastics for All
-
Objectives
Objectives
The teaching of the curricular unit has as objectives the appropriation by the students of pedagogical-professional knowledge, skills, habits, and abilities, necessary to conduct the teaching-learning process, within the system sports, in the related cultural matter – Gymnastics, in the disciplines of: Artistic; Trampolines; Acrobatic and Group.
